Witryna30 mar 2024 · Explanation: Importance of specific heat to a biological system: Living organism can survive and reproduce only if their temperatures are maintained within a limited range. For aquatic organisms the high heat capacity of water means that their environment maintains a much more stable temperature than on land. Witryna20 lut 2024 · The specific heat is the amount of heat necessary to change the temperature of 1.00 kg of mass by 1.00oC. The specific heat c is a property of the substance; its SI unit is J / (kg ⋅ K) or J / (kg ⋅oC). Recall that the temperature change (ΔT) is the same in units of kelvin and degrees Celsius. Witryna6 lis 2024 · Heat capacity is a measure of the heat required to raise the temperature of 1g of a substance by 1 Celsius. In this example, water has a very high heat capacity, which means it requires a lot of heat or energy to change temperature compared to many other substances like the pot. Witryna1 mar 2014 · Importance of specific heats towards increasing engine efficiency was quantified. • Decreases of specific heats contribute 3.5–6.3% (abs) to the efficiency. • Dilute engines benefit from decreases of specific heats due to lower temperatures.
